Property managers in Mississippi oversee residential and commercial properties to ensure efficient operation and tenant satisfaction. They handle leases, maintenance, and complaints. Real estate managers focus on property sales and tenant placements. Community managers engage with residents and manage communal property issues and events. Mississippi Property / Real Estate / Community Manager Industry Trends & Salary Information

Property / Real Estate / Community Managers in Mississippi oversee the management, operation, and maintenance of residential or commercial properties within the state. - Entry-level Property Manager salaries range from $30,000 to $40,000 per year - Mid-career Real Estate Manager salaries range from $50,000 to $70,000 per year - Senior-level Community Manager salaries range from $70,000 to $90,000 per year The role of a Property / Real Estate / Community Manager in Mississippi has a rich history dating back to the establishment of towns and cities in the state. These managers have played a crucial role in the development and growth of real estate properties, ensuring their upkeep and value. Over time, the responsibilities of Property / Real Estate / Community Managers in Mississippi have evolved to include more focus on customer service, sustainability practices, and compliance with regulations. The increasing complexity of property management tasks has led to the need for specialized skills and knowledge in the field. Current trends in the property management industry in Mississippi include the adoption of technology solutions for efficient operations, the implementation of green initiatives for sustainability, and the growing emphasis on community-building within residential complexes. Property / Real Estate / Community Managers are also exploring new ways to enhance the overall living experience for residents through amenities and services.
